#F16875 Hex Color Code

#F16875

The Hexadecimal Color #F16875 is a contrast shade of Salmon. #F16875 RGB value is rgb(241, 104, 117). RGB Color Model of #F16875 consists of 94% red, 40% green and 45% blue. HSL color Mode of #F16875 has 354°(degrees) Hue, 83% Saturation and 68% Lightness. #F16875 color has an wavelength of 397.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#F16875 is #FF9999.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#F16875 is #E67. The Closest Color to #F16875 is #FA8072. Official Name of #F16875 Hex Code is Brink Pink.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#F16875 is 0 Cyan 57 Magenta 51 Yellow 5 Black and #F16875 CMY is 0, 57, 51.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#F16875 is hsl(354,83,68,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(354, 57, 95).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#F16875 is 44.44, 29.89, 20.26.
Hex8 Value of #F16875 is #F16875FF. Decimal Value of #F16875 is 15820917 and Octal Value of #F16875 is 74264165. Binary Value of #F16875 is 11110001, 1101000, 1110101 and Android of #F16875 is 4294010997 / 0xfff16875.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#F16875 is 0.47, 0.316, 0.316 and YIQ Color Space of #F16875 is 146.445, 77.4614, 33.0211.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#F16875 is 42.12, 19.59, 20.46.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#F16875 is 61.56, 53.77, 19.54.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#F16875 is 61.56, 98.65, 14.09.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#F16875 is 61.56, 57.21, 19.97. Hunter Lab variable of #F16875 is 54.67, 49.42, 16.3.

Various Color Shades of #F16875

To get 25% Saturated #F16875 Color, you need to convert the hex color #F16875 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#F16875 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#F16875

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
